Biography

Antonio Cipriano (born May 13, 2000) is an American actor/singer of Lebanese and Italian descent. He was involved in numerous local and school theatre productions, and represented Michigan at the 2017 National High School Musical Theater Awards (also known as the Jimmy Awards). In 2018, Cipriano was casted in the original production of Jagged Little Pills before reprising his role in the Broadway Production of the same musical in 2019, making it his official Broadway debut. The musical won 2 out of its 15 nominations at the Tony Awards. As the originating role of Phoenix, he is part of the original cast soundtrack album that won the Grammy for Best Musical Theater Album. Some of his onscreen works include National Treasure: Edge of History (2022), Pretty Little Liars: Original Sin (2024) and A Week Away (2025). Cipriano is best known for his role as John Logan in Off Campus (2026-present). He made his feature film debut starring as Young Vito in The Alto Knights (2025).
